Restrict KIST parameter range and make a separate client param
Network parameter KISTSchedRunInterval is allowed to be between 0 and 100, with the idea that 0 disables KIST, and 1-100 are interval values in ms. However, the code path to disable KIST via this param is broken due to additional safety checks elsewhere, and 1ms drives relays into 100% CPU loop.
We should change the allowed range of this param to be 2-100 (though 100 is awful high).
While at it, we should make a separate KISTSchedRunIntervalClient param, so we can control client and relay KIST values separately.
